Compare Ceres to Fallbrook

This post compares Ceres, California to Fallbrook,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Ceres (city) Fallbrook (CDP)
Population 47,650 31,121
Income (median) $37,711 $36,878
Home Value (median) $218,300 $463,400
White 64% 78%
Black 3% 2%
Asian 6% 3%
With Kids 54% 34%
Age (median) 30 37
Rentals 40% 40%
